CHI CHI 1.75L STRAWBERRY MARGARITA

CHI CHI 1.75L STRAWBERRY MARGARITA
$9.99
SKU
89000019182
In Stock
CHI CHI 1.75L STRAWBERRY MARGARITA
CHI CHI 1.75L STRAWBERRY MARGARITA